How to Make a Hydraulic Forging Press
time:2023-10-29 views:(点击 1,010 次)
Forging is a metalworking technique used to transform metal by applying pressure. Mechanical hammers are typically employed, while hydraulic and screw presses may add greater power and control during this process.
These presses operate slowly, using fluid pressure to convert pressure into mechanical force and are commonly employed for open die forging applications.
Frame
Hydraulic forging presses differ significantly from shop presses in that they must withstand continuous use for multiple cycles at once, heat transfer and cooling cycles as well as ongoing stresses such as heating/cooling cycles without failing or becoming damaged. Therefore, proper construction of such presses must take place to avoid failure or damage to them in their service life.
Hydraulic forging presses rely on their frame as the foundation to the rest of the machine, with various kinds of frames used depending on individual circumstances and needs. While various kinds can be chosen, forging presses with good rigidity are preferred to reduce any potential flexing which could reduce pressure applied to workpieces while simultaneously improving precision during forging operations.
Hydraulic forging presses require not only a frame, but also a hydraulic cylinder, oil tank, manual control valve, pressure gauge and pressing plate for operation. The hydraulic cylinder provides unidirectional stroke force to push metal into dies through pressing plates connected to it - the pressure gauge allows users to track exactly how much pressure is being applied - manual control valves allow operators to control how much is being applied - while oil tanks store all necessary hydraulic fluid for operating its cylinders.
Forging is most successful when the hydraulic press ram can contact the die at the bottom of each stroke, acting like molds to shape metal into specific forms. Open and closed dies can both be used, although closed dies tend to be used more commonly for isothermal applications.
Forging presses have the advantage of applying force gradually over a longer time than hammers, enabling the ram to penetrate deeper into the workpiece and result in more uniform plastic deformation. While forging presses may be used with all alloy groups, they are particularly advantageous when working with alloys that require slow deformation rates.
Forging presses can be used for both impression die and open die forging, and are classified either mechanically or hydraulically depending on how energy is delivered to the workpiece. Hydraulic presses typically deliver energy more slowly than mechanical hammers and therefore make an ideal choice when forging alloys such as 7xxx series aluminum and magnesium alloys which require slower deformation rates.
